another great truck from tracker. it was well worth the wait.
Equipment Reviews
How long have you ridden them?: 2 months
What Setup are you running them on?: tried them on a dervish and hellcat
Typical Discepline?: carving, DH
How much did you pay for them?: wholesale for our shop, $120 NZD retail
Where did you buy them?: from climax
What are their weaknesses?: no weaknes except when using them on some drop thoughs when you flip the hanger. if its a thick deck like the demonseed, the base of the hanger tends to hit the inside walls of the drop through hole which limits turning and can damage a bit of the inside of the hole. when unflipped, its perfect. it still fits most drop throughs even if the hanger is flipped.
What are their strengths?: super stable when tightened. can carve real nice too. the hanger also has a bushing seat for standard bushings so you dont have to stick with their simulators if you dont want to. go buy em. ive used them with khiros and work nicely. i also love that they come with the flat washers. finally..
What similar equipment have you ridden?: randal 180s, paris 180s, holeys, grizzlys.
Would you recommend them?: Yes
